The Teamwork Advanced Course is tailored to propel you from being a competent Teamwork user, to being able to master the full set of Teamwork features.
This course will impart technical skills, practical advice, and best practices when using the advanced features of Teamwork, and is particularly useful for account and project administrators, or team leaders who need to have oversight in projects.
You will proceed from being able to “get the job done”, to being as efficient as possible within your Teamwork environment, through using shortcuts, and setting up templates and defaults for project spaces. You will be freed up to do the work instead of spending all of your time planning it out.
The course is comprised of three sections, each building upon the skills learnt in the last as you set course for project management mastery.
